LOCATION and COMFORT: Lake front on a deep water cove with room for a boat and excellent swimming. This 2023 lake house has 3 comfortable bedrooms and 2 baths with 2 private bedrooms with king beds and 1 private bedroom with 2 XLong twins comfortable for up to 6 adults or a family. We know the key to a good vacation is getting rest and being able to enjoy the day ahead and the house breaths comfort.
This open concept lake house has plenty of space for cooking, reading and watching a movie with 4 TVs. The 3 season screened in porch has a dining table with 8 chairs and a fabulous view of the aqua green deep water cove and dock.
Start the day on the deck with a cup of coffee and watch the cardinals and yellow finch fly about. You may see a fawn getting breakfast or the harmless Pike Nose turtle, as nature abounds and helps to set the calm tone for a lake inspired day ahead.
The house is equipped with most amenities including a beverage refrigerator, hp printer, slow-cooker, Insta-pot, blender, toaster oven, 2 drip coffee makers, hand mixer and Corelle-ware for 12. Plenty of towels and beach towels are provided along with 2 fans and a blow dryer and 4 lifejackets suitable for children. If you need to do a load of laundry, there is a washer and dryer for guest convenience. At the end of the day, pour your favorite beverage and gather on the porch for a relaxing time before dinner. Note: there is an electric smoker and small charcoal grill, no fire pit.
The house is on an incline with a new sturdy staircase from the sun deck right to the dock and there is a gravel rock path from the house to the dock. Once you're on the dock you can enjoy the view out the cove, the large calm swimming area, safe for children with no wake and a relaxed atmosphere (there is a ladder on the dock to enter the water, no beach).
The water at Lake Norman in the summer is warm and inviting. Bring a boat or rent one from our referral with Mike and Kimberly at UD Boat rentals (we can provide contact information). The rental will be at the dock waiting for you with their no hassle use plan. Go tubing, skiing, knee boarding or just explore with a pontoon boat. If you are here to fish, rent a boat and troll the coves around LKN State Park which is directly across from our cove. If you are bringing your own boat, let us know so we have a slip ready.
Cool weather and fall foliage is spectacular on the lake. The house is very comfortable for family gatherings year round. Hiking/biking at both the local LKN State Park (2.5 miles away) or in the nearby foothills are well worth the trip. Spring at LKN is beautiful. The yard is full of forsythia, holly, azalea and many NC wild flowers. The water is warm enough to swim in May but kayaking is fantastic when the weather is cool. There is a small island and sand bar between the cove and the LKN State Park that is great for exploring. If you are intown for a Chickadee Hill Farms wedding or event, we welcome you and let us know the occassion.
Troutman (6 miles) is a small town away from the crowds of Mooresville. There is a everything needed to make your stay convenient: Food Lion Grocery, Troutman Bakery, Pat's Place ice cream, Randy's BBQ, Dunkin Donuts/ Your Place Coffee House, farmers market, Dollar General, 4 gas stations, Bait and Tackle shop, Walgreens, ABC Liquor, Dominos Pizza, Truist Bank, US Post Office, library and plenty more. We are 4 miles from Chickadee Farms wedding and event venue, 5 miles to Daveste Vineyards.
